A bilateral discussion took place between Afghan and Iranian delegations, focusing on decisions concerning the Chabahar port and the Azadi area.
The Ministry of Industry and Trade reported that a meeting was held between representatives of the Islamic Emirate and an Iranian delegation led by Minister Nouruddin Azizi and Governor of Sistan and Balochistan Mohammad Karmi.
During this meeting, the Ministry of Industry and Trade indicated that the discussions revolved around the execution of agreements established during the visit of Mullah Abdul Ghani Baradar Akhund, Deputy Minister of Economy, to Iran, specifically regarding the Chabahar Port and Free Zone.
It was stated by the ministry that a technical committee was formed from officials of both parties to delve deeper into these matters and ensure the implementation of the agreed-upon decisions.
